Rainbow Blossom Natural Food

Shopping & Stores in Louisville

Rainbow Blossom Natural Food in Louisville, KY is a B2C Shopping & Stores related to Miscellaneous Food Stores, Health Foods, Retail Trade

Address & Contact Edit

Street: 3608 Springhurst Boulevard
City: Louisville
Zip: 40241
Phone: 5023395090

Map & Directions